(I didn't know where to post this exactly, but since OPL is used to load games from both USB and internal HDD, I believe that in certain cases saving HDD space could be quite important)
Last time I shrinked a game image was years ago and I did it manually, extracting all files and then rebuilding a new image with "Sony cd-dvd generator". That's a long process, and it takes too much time, specially sorting the files to respect LBA order.
Is there any new tool for doing that automatically? I am talking only about removing dummy sectors or dummy files, not anything else.
P.S.: And all this because I just saw that a game image size was 4.2GB but it has only 800MB of real data, and I am running out of HDD space.

UltraISO rebuilds a PS2 disc flawlessly and you don't need to do nothing complicated... just modify/replace the files you wish and save.

USB Util software can do that too, with just few clicks. Open the ISO ("Open ISO to"), right-click it and "Rip Game ISO".
